  • Before we unzip anything, let’s analyze the naming convention. In software distribution, filenames are a roadmap. Here is the breakdown of Repair-Module-V3.2-UltimatePOS-utd.zip:

    | Component | Meaning | | :--- | :--- | | Repair-Module | Indicates this is not a core feature installer. It is a diagnostic/repair utility designed to fix broken installations, missing tables, or synchronization errors. | | V3.2 | Specifies the version compatibility. This module is built specifically for UltimatePOS version 3.2.x. Using it on v3.0 or v4.0 could cause catastrophic failures. | | UltimatePOS | The target software ecosystem. | | utd | Most likely an acronym. In POS circles, "UTD" often stands for "Up-To-Date" or sometimes a developer’s initials. It suggests this is a patched or revised edition of an older repair script. | | .zip | A compressed archive.     Given this nomenclature, the file is almost certainly a third-party or community-developed repair kit, not an official release from the UltimatePOS core team (who typically use naming like UltimatePOS_v3.2_patch_official.zip).
